Software Technical Due Diligence

At BroadRock Insights, our Software Technical Due Diligence service is designed to provide investors, enterprises, and organizations with a clear and comprehensive understanding of the technical capabilities, risks, and potential of software products and platforms. Whether you’re evaluating an acquisition, merger, or investment opportunity, our expertise ensures informed decisions and reduced risks.

Why Software Technical Due Diligence Matters

In today’s fast-paced digital landscape, software lies at the core of most business operations. Understanding the health, scalability, and alignment of a software product with business objectives is critical. Technical due diligence goes beyond surface-level reviews, diving deep into the architecture, codebase, development practices, and more to provide actionable insights.

What We Cover

  1. Codebase Analysis:
    • Assessment of code quality, maintainability, and technical debt.
    • Identification of vulnerabilities and inefficiencies in the codebase.
  2. Architecture & Scalability:
    • Review of software architecture for scalability, performance, and reliability.
    • Assessment of suitability for future growth and technology trends.
  3. Development Practices:
    • Evaluation of development workflows, tooling, and processes.
    • Review of DevOps practices and CI/CD pipeline effectiveness.
  4. Technology Stack Assessment:
    • Suitability and relevance of the current technology stack.
    • Compatibility with business goals and industry standards.
  5. Security & Compliance:
    • Identification of security vulnerabilities and gaps.
    • Review of compliance with industry regulations and standards (e.g., GDPR, SOC 2).
  6. Third-Party Dependencies:
    • Analysis of open-source and proprietary software dependencies.
    • Assessment of licensing risks and potential legal liabilities.
  7. Team & Leadership Evaluation:
    • Review of the technical team’s structure, skills, and effectiveness.
    • Analysis of technical leadership and its alignment with project goals.

Our Approach

  • Collaborative Discovery:
    We engage with stakeholders to define key objectives, risks, and areas of focus.
  • Comprehensive Assessment:
    Using a combination of manual reviews, automated tools, and interviews, we evaluate all technical aspects of the software.
  • Tailored Recommendations:
    We provide a detailed report with actionable insights, highlighting strengths, risks, and opportunities for improvement.
  • Support Beyond Delivery:
    Our team remains available to guide you through implementation, negotiations, or additional technical reviews as needed.

Who Benefits from Our Service?

  • Investors: Gain clarity on the value and risks of software assets before acquisition or investment.
  • Enterprises: Ensure software acquisitions align with strategic goals and are free from technical pitfalls.
  • Startups: Prepare for due diligence by identifying and addressing technical gaps proactively.

Why Choose BroadRock Insights?

  • Proven Expertise: Years of experience working with global organizations across industries.
  • Cutting-Edge Tools: Leveraging the latest in AI, automation, and manual expertise for detailed analysis.
  • Unbiased Insights: A transparent and independent review process to empower decision-making.

Rooted in NYC, Serving the World

From the bustling streets of New York City to the global stage, BroadRock Insights brings local expertise with international reach. While our roots are in NYC, our services extend far and wide. From Silicon Valley startups to European enterprises and government organizations, we provide expert insights and tailored solutions to clients across the globe.

Let’s Get Started

Scroll to Top